Relevant Research Between Dual-source And Dual-energy CT Multiple Quantitative Parameters And Gastric Adenocarcinoma

Objective: To investigate the diagnostic efficacy of multiple quantitative parameters of dual-source CT in gastric adenocarcinoma during portal period.To evaluate the value of multiple quantitative parameters of dual-source CT in evaluating the degree of pathological differentiation of gastric adenocarcinoma in portal phase.To explore the correlation between the CT values of three phases enhanced and multiple quantitative parameters of dual-source dual-energy CT in portal phase and whether HER2 is overexpressed.Methods: A retrospective analysis was performed on 106 patients with gastric adenocarcinoma who underwent dual-source and dual-energy CT scans and obtained definite pathological results in shaanxi people's hospital from July 2018 to October2019,of which 102 were gastric tubular adenocarcinoma(21 were highly differentiated adenocarcinoma,31 were moderately differentiated adenocarcinoma,and 50 were poorly differentiated adenocarcinoma).30 normal gastric wall were used as the control group.34 cases of the 102 gastric tubular adenocarcinoma patients with gastric cancer by gastroscope biopsy got pathology results,68 patients with postoperative specimen got pathological results,postoperative specimens' HER2 is clear,including HER2 positive 12 cases and HER2 negative 56 cases.They all underwent dual source CT scan.The dual-energy images of portal period were obtained by the second-generation dual-source CT scan of Siemens,and the energy spectrum curve,the iodine concentration of portal period and the iodine concentration of the same aorta were obtained by syngo.via software.After calculation,the slope of the energy spectrum curve and the standardized iodine concentration were obtained.The CT values of the arterial phase,portal phase and equilibrium phase were measured on the original image.The data were divided into normal gastric wall and gastric adenocarcinoma groups,high,medium and low differentiated gastric adenocarcinoma groups,HER2 positive group and HER2 negative group.The statistical methods were Kappa consistency test,ROC curve method,two independent samples T test and variance analysis.Results: there was a strong consistency between biopsy and postoperative of pathological results(Kappa coefficient was 0.871),and and it was no significant difference(P<0.001).It indicates that biopsy results can basically replace postoperative pathological results.The slope of energy spectrum curve between normal gastric and gastric adenocarcinoma(1.35±0.24,2.77±0.67)was statistically significant(P<0.05),and the standardized iodine concentration(0.31±0.08,0.53±0.25)was statistically significant(P<0.05).The area under the curve of slope and standardized iodine concentration were 0.996 and 0.883 respectively.The spectrum curve slope of highly differentiated,moderately differentiated and poorly differentiated gastric adenocarcinoma(2.18±0.37,2.69±0.56,3.07±0.66)were statistically significant between and within the groups(P<0.05).Standardized iodine concentration in portal phase of high,medium and low differentiation(0.33±0.53,0.50±0.11,0.63±0.30)gastric adenocarcinoma showed statistically significant differences between the groups(P<0.05).There were no significant differences between the moderately differentiated group and the poorly differentiated group(P>0.05).However the differences between the highly differentiated group and the moderately differentiated group or the poorly differentiated group(P<0.05)were significant.The CT values of portal period between the positive group and the negative group(99.33±4.367,75.75±10.198)were statistically significant(P<0.05),while there was no significant difference(P>0.05)between the CT values of the arterial period(53.50±6.775,52.30±10.968)and the equilibrium period(103.67±10.367,78.54±13.894).The differences in slope value and normalized iodine concentration between HER2 positive group and negative group(P>0.05)were unconspicuous.Conclusion:(1)dual-energy parameters are effective in the diagnosis of gastric cancer,providing the possibility for non-invasive diagnosis of gastric cancer;(2)As a new diagnostic technique,dual-energy parameters provide a new method and idea for the clinical differentiation of gastric cancer,and can be used as a reference index for the evaluation of the differentiation of gastric cancer.(3)There was a difference in the degree of portal venous enhancement between the HER2 positive group and the HER2 negative group,but there was no significant correlation between the HER2 protein in gastric cancer and the slope of the corresponding energy spectrum curve and the standardized iodine concentration.
